Pours a dark golden color with a frothy white head into my glass. This is the first batch of Gallantry in cans and instead of a proper label (due to a mistake), it has the name and brewery in ink.
Curious citrus note followed by a light pine aroma.
Crisp and buttery, leaning between american and british pale ale in profile.
Finish is reminiscent of the smell of fresh cut grass. Makes me yearn for springtime.
As you sip this ale, imagine yourself on a John Deere riding mower, can of Gallantry in the cupholder and the sun in your eyes. Isn't that what springtime in Vermont feels like?
